Request for 8-Year Exception• New procedure started late spring• Form is a Word document that is first completed by

the student, then by Program Director, then emailed to Julie.

• Any course recommended for exception must include an academic rationale– May need to consult faculty member if in different

discipline• Expected date of graduate must be included– “Expiration date of decision”– Helps in determining whether others fall outside 8-year

window

Dismissal from Program

• Monday after commencement, the GC runs a report containing students who have accumulated more than 9 hours of grades below B-– We know there are a few exception programs

• Student notified by Wednesday (DH and PD copied)– Exceeded limit of grades below B-– Will be administratively dropped from program Friday before

classes start– May appeal between now and then (details regarding

available slots provided)• Appeal committee consists of departmental reps, Grad Dean, Grad

Associate Dean

GEN 798 – Active in Research

• Zero credit hour course (still just $75)• For those students with only their research

requirement remaining to be completed• Provides the following:–Access to the library–Opportunity to purchase a parking pass–Access to computer services, including

e-mail• Graded as a “P” or “N”• Register online like any other course

Financial Aid• Enhancing Diversity Scholarships

• $ 1,000 per semester; • Up to 15, with up to five reserved for eligible grad

students pursuing degrees/certificates in teacher education

• Need-Based Scholarship• $1,000 per semester; total potential value of $3,000• 50 available per year

• Financial Aid Loans• In degree programs & most certificate programs• Unsubsidized • 150% of initial grad program eligibility

• Work study
